Japanese exporters start to sell HRC for August shipment, target higher prices

Friday, 05 June 2020 14:46:48 (GMT+3)   |   Istanbul

Japanese suppliers have been insisting on higher HRC prices this week. One lot of 40,000 mt of SAE1006 coils has been sold to Vietnam at $435/mt CFR or slightly above for August shipment, which is equivalent to $420-425/mt FOB. Offers have been already heard from two major exporters from Japan at $450/mt CFR to Vietnam this week.

Also a deal for 30,000 mt of Japanese HRC has been signed at $425/mt CFR to Pakistan this week. Japanese coils for July shipment have been traded at $410-420/mt CFR Pakistan, as reported earlier.

The above booking signals a price increase compared to July shipment sales, which have been mainly below $400/mt FOB. Nevertheless, sources believe that, following some worsening of sentiments in China, it will be hard to achieve a further increase in deal prices in the near future.

“Suppliers will aim for a price increase in major markets [other Southeast Asian countries than Vietnam, Bangladesh, Pakistan and the Middle East]. For now, sales for August shipments have just started,” a Japanese trader said.
